The forecasted import of natural uranium to the UK shows a steady increase from 2024 to 2028, with yearly volumes rising from 2.71 to 3.3 thousand kilograms. In 2023, the import volume was lower, reflecting the growth trajectory for the coming years. The year-on-year percentage variation is consistent, suggesting a stable demand increase.
Key future trends to monitor include:
- Global geopolitical developments influencing uranium supply chains.
- Progress in nuclear energy adoption as part of the UK's energy transition efforts.
- Technological advancements in uranium extraction and processing methods.
